The Smithsonian Institution will publish the research done by Mack McCormick into Johnson's life and death this coming April 2023:

Biography of a Phantom

I assume the serious blues people on Mudcat know of McCormick.

Smithsonian has previously published a collection of his writings: The Blues Come To Texas.

77Records (UK) published 2 LPs of his recordings with extensive annotations. At least one volume issued by Candid in the US.

McCormick did extensive field work, and recorded and annotated many recordings.

Also one of the people who recorded an amazing collection of Bawdy traditions: The Unexpurgated Songs of Men (Arhoolie using RAGLAN label).
